What You'll Do:

  • Provide excellent customer service by carrying out security-related procedures and following site-specific policies within the healthcare location.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, supporting emergency response activities as needed.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ols throughout the facility and its perimeter to help to deter unauthorized activity and identify potential issues.
  • Maintain awareness of the surroundings and report any suspicious behavior or conditions to the appropriate personnel.
  • Work collaboratively with facility staff and visitors to address questions or concerns related to security-related matters.
  • Complete required documentation and incident reports accurately and promptly as part of daily responsibilities.
